Lawyers Commend Supreme Court
Human rights lawyer, Bamidele Aturu, on Friday described the judgment as sound, legal, morally justifiable.
Aturu said, “INEC was wrong in trying to give effect to the 2007 annulled elections in the five states. There is no ambiguity in Section 180 of the 1999 Constitution as amended as it states clearly that the tenure of a governor shall be four years, starting from the day he takes Oath of Office and Oath of Allegiance.”
Reacting, Adegboruwa advised that all matters arising henceforth, from an election should concluded before a declared winners took oath of office.
“Whatever circumstance that may warrant a governor spending a day beyond his first four years term or second eight years is fraudulent. And indeed I have suspected all along that some smart governors may have colluded with fellow politicians to sponsor frivolous election petitions in court as a means of ‘nullifying’ their elections, get the tribunals to order fresh elections, leading to a fresh tenure.
“There is no basis for this constitutional fraud at all. And it is indeed soothing that the Supreme Court has put judicial end to the ambitions of these governors,” he stated.
